Structures are also correlated with the environmental biodegradability of a molecule. Thus, in view of increasing environmental legislation [6], QSBR models play an important role in predicting the biodegradability of a molecule. [Pg.135]

Nowadays, the different branches of research in biodegradation modeling try to overcome the problems encountered with the classical QSBR models. Thus, because it is necessary to use different endpoints for describing the biodegradation process of oiganic chemicals and also because the experimental conditions greatly influence the biodegradation results, attempts have been made to model this property by means of multivariate statistical approaches such as co-inertia analysis. ... [Pg.937]

An important point is determining to what extent these results relate to actual biodegradation potential of the compounds concerned. In other words, could the regression models be considered QSBRs. This is of particular significance because a lack of reproducible quantitative data on biodegradation is one of the factors that limits the development of QSBRs (Degner et al., 1991). [Pg.388]
